What the Weather Will Be
Expect a cool evening: the forecast calls for a high near 60°F with mostly sunny skies during the day. The National Weather Service is calling for a slight chance of rain showers (23% probability), and winds will be steady at 16 mph from the west. It’s not a soaking rain scenario, but it’s real enough that you should be prepared.
What to Wear
60°F is crisp—especially once the sun dips lower and that 16 mph wind picks up. Layer up:
- Base layer: Long sleeves or a light sweater
- Outer layer: A packable rain jacket is your MVP here. It’ll shield you from both the slight rain chance and the wind without weighing you down
- Bottoms: Jeans or pants (skip the shorts)
- Footwear: Closed-toe shoes are essential—the ground may be damp from the slight chance of showers
